Japan's Regulated Yen Stablecoin: SBI & Startale Lead Token Economy Shift
Japanese financial giant SBI Holdings and Web3 infrastructure firm Startale Group have signed an MoU to develop a regulated Japanese yen stablecoin targeted for launch in Q2 2026. The stablecoin will be issued and redeemed by Shinsei Trust & Banking, a subsidiary of SBI Shinsei Bank, while SBI VC Trade, a licensed crypto asset exchange, will handle its circulation.

Weekly Crypto Regulation Roundup: SEC Crackdown, Privacy Fears, and Legal Battles in Washington
The SEC’s Crypto Task Force has scheduled a public “Roundtable on Financial Surveillance and Privacy” at its Washington, D.C. headquarters. The session, led by Commissioner Hester Peirce, will gather regulators, technologists, market participants, and civil-liberties advocates to discuss how oversight should work in an on-chain world where transactions are transparent by default but users still expect some level of privacy.

France’s crypto paradox: tax “unproductive” holdings, hoard 420K BTC
France is weighing two contradictory crypto policies that signal a split vision in Paris: treating digital assets as taxable “unproductive” wealth while pursuing a strategic national Bitcoin reserve. A first-reading amendment in the French National Assembly rebrands the real-estate-focused wealth tax into a broader tax on “unproductive wealth,” explicitly including digital assets.

FCA Sues HTX in London for Illegal Crypto Promotions: What UK Exchanges Must Know
The UK's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) has initiated a civil lawsuit against HTX, formerly Huobi, in London's High Court. The regulator accuses the global crypto exchange of illegally promoting cryptoasset services to UK consumers without proper authorization or registration, marking a significant escalation in the FCA's efforts to enforce its new financial promotions regime for digital assets.

BlackRock Launches iShares Bitcoin ETP (IB1T) on LSE: UK Gets Regulated Spot BTC Access
BlackRock has launched the iShares Bitcoin ETP (ticker: IB1T) on the London Stock Exchange, giving UK retail investors regulated, direct exposure to spot Bitcoin for the first time. The physically backed ETP removes the need for self-custody while tracking BTC’s spot price, and debuted at $11.10, rising 5.54% on day one. Bank of England Clarifies Stablecoin Caps Are Temporary: What It Means for UK Crypto
The Bank of England (BoE) has clarified that its proposed caps on stablecoin holdings and transaction sizes are intended to be temporary safeguards, not permanent barriers to digital asset adoption. Speaking at DC Fintech Week, Deputy Governor Sarah Breeden emphasized the BoE’s aim to support a role for regulated stablecoins within a “multi‑money system” while preserving financial stability during the transition.

Ripple CEO Demands Equal Regulatory Footing for Crypto & TradFi
Ripple CEO Brad Garlinghouse is urging U.S. policymakers to treat compliant crypto companies on par with traditional finance (TradFi) institutions. Speaking at DC Fintech Week, he said firms that meet Anti-Money Laundering (AML), Know Your Customer (KYC), and Office of Foreign Assets Control (OFAC) standards should receive the same regulatory benefits as banks—most notably access to a Federal Reserve “master account.”

Kenya Approves Virtual Asset Law: Parliament Pushes Crypto Legitimacy and Regulation
Kenya’s Parliament has approved the Virtual Asset Service Providers (VASP) Bill in a major push to legitimize cryptocurrencies, with the measure now awaiting President William Ruto’s assent. The law aims to create a licensing and supervisory framework for crypto exchanges and wallets, strengthen consumer protection, and align with anti-money laundering and counter-terrorist financing (AML/CFT) standards.

Stablecoin Revolution: How BoE Exemptions Position UK as a Global Crypto Hub
The Bank of England (BoE) plans to exempt crypto exchanges and other operationally critical firms from proposed stablecoin holding limits, a move that could channel significant liquidity into Bitcoin (BTC) and Ethereum (ETH). By granting waivers for market-making and settlement operations—and allowing stablecoins for settlement in the Digital Securities Sandbox—the BoE addresses industry concerns that previous caps were unworkable.

UK Crypto ETNs Return for Retail: FCA Approval and LSE Listing Delays Explained
The UK’s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) has lifted its ban on crypto exchange-traded products for retail investors, opening the door to Bitcoin and Ethereum-linked exchange-traded notes (cETNs) as part of the country’s push to become a global “crypto hub.” However, despite headlines that the “UK crypto ban is lifted,” retail investors still can’t buy immediately due to administrative holdups.

Australian Crypto Exchanges Face Stricter Oversight Under Draft Legislation
Australia has unveiled draft legislation to tighten oversight of crypto exchanges, bringing digital asset platforms under the same rules as traditional financial services. The proposal, described by Assistant Treasurer Daniel Mulino as the cornerstone of the government’s digital asset roadmap, would create two new financial products under the Corporations Act: “digital asset platforms” and “tokenized custody platforms.”

EU Crypto Regulation: France Pushes for Stricter MiCA Enforcement & ESMA Oversight
France is taking a hardline stance against crypto firms operating under the European Union’s Markets in Crypto-Assets Regulation (MiCA) due to perceived regulatory loopholes. The French financial regulator, Autorité des Marchés Financiers (AMF), warned it may block companies that use MiCA’s “passporting rights” to enter France through licenses from jurisdictions with weaker oversight.

GOP Crypto Bill Stalls as Senator Warns “We’re Not Ready” — What It Means for Bitcoin & Blockchain
The long-anticipated GOP crypto bill has run into political headwinds after Senator John Kennedy (R-La.) warned that lawmakers are “not ready” to move forward. The bill, designed to establish a regulatory framework for digital assets in the U.S., aimed to clarify oversight between the SEC and CFTC, while also providing guidelines around stablecoins and consumer protections.

Digital Assets on the Docket: Senate Unveils Major Crypto Regulatory Overhaul
The U.S. Senate Banking Committee has released a new discussion draft called the “Responsible Financial Innovation Act,” aiming to overhaul the regulatory framework for digital assets in the United States. This draft, which follows the recent CLARITY Act, seeks to provide clearer definitions and regulatory boundaries for digital assets, with a strong focus on investor protection and regulatory clarity.

Crypto Custody Gets a Rulebook: OCC, Fed, and FDIC Set New Standards for Banks
The Office of the Comptroller of the Currency (OCC), Federal Reserve (Fed), and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ation (FDIC) have jointly issued new guidance clarifying how U.S. banks can offer crypto custody services. The agencies emphasized that existing banking regulations for fiduciary duty, custody, and information security already provide a framework for safeguarding digital assets.
